Why Choose a Braided Ponytail?

Before diving into the styling process, let’s talk about why the braided ponytail is more than just a middle-school hairdo—it’s a modern staple:

  • Easy to Create: No special tools or high-maintenance styling required.
  • Great for All Hair Types: Blends seamlessly with straight, curly, thick, or fine hair.
  • Versatile Appeal: Works for casual outings, formal events, and everything in between.
  • Maximizes Volume & Control: Brings body to flat or limp hair while keeping it manageable.
  • Flattering for Face Shapes: keeps the focus on your face and adds softness without bulk.

Top 5 Braided Ponytail Styles to Try

  1. Classic French Braided Ponytail
    A timeless option, the French braid transitions smoothly into a high or low ponytail. Start at the crown, wrap hair gently over one side, and secure with a sturdy yet decorative hair tie. Perfect for work or date nights.

  2. Skinny Braided Llama Ponytail
    For texture lovers, this style features tightly woven, small braids piled neatly. It adds volume while staying sleek—ideal for shoulder-length or longer hair.

  3. Fishtail Braid with Ponytail
    Combining the elegance of a fishtail braid with a ponytail gives a bohemian vibe. Secure mid-length braids and pull them into a loose top knot or low ponytail for a relaxed, romantic look.

  4. Box Braids and Ponytail
    Mixing box braids with a ponytail offers drama and durability. Keep braids neat and tied in place, then secure into a ponytail for a bold, curated style—popular in both streetwear and high fashion.

Step-by-Step: How to Make a Perfect Braided Ponytail

What You’ll Need:

  • Hairbrush, bet (or hairpins)
  • Hair tie (strong, small-diameter)
  • Optional: hair clips, hairspray, texturizing spray

Steps:

  1. Prep Your Hair: Start with clean, dry locks for better grip. Detangle and style with light spray to prevent frizz.
  2. Create the Braid: Divide hair into 2–3 sections. Learn a basic three-strand braid and build upward toward your crown.
  3. Braid to ponytail height: Finish the braid in a snug but not tight bun at the desired ponytail length.
  4. Secure & Smooth: Use bobby pins to hide the braid edges and secure the ponytail base. Smooth flyaways with hairspray for a polished look.
  5. Accessorize: Add decorative clips, pearls, or bows to elevate your style. For extra hold, wrap a satin ribbon around the ponytail.
